2005-05-26, 02:45 PM
snow problem and conflicts solved I guess...

I had 2 capture sources and gbpvr (one for normal tv, one for my premiere box).
gbpvr added all normal channels to the 2nd capture device (with diff channelnumbers).
I guess that caused some conflicts and the snowing.
Also this was the reason for the none conflict warning, as gbpvr of course thought it can record both the same time...
I disabled them and now it is o.k. again.

No sound in Live TV:
In Timeshift mode sound is o.k. (as in recordings) - only no sound on exclusive Live TV
